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Youngs Creek, is another warm month, with an average temperature varying between 85.5°F (29.7°C) and 62.6°F (17°C).

Temperature

The commencement of August notes an average high-temperature of a warm 85.5°F (29.7°C), exhibiting little difference from the previous month. Marked by a significant drop from the daytime highs, Youngs Creek's average low-temperature in August stands at a comfortable 62.6°F (17°C).

Heat index

During August, the heat index is computed to be a very hot 96.8°F (36°C). Implement additional safety measures to avoid heat cramps and heat exhaustion. Persistent activity might trigger heatstroke.
One should consider that heat index numbers are for shaded settings and light wind. A rise of up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ees in the heat index could result from dire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', evaluates the perceived heat by adding the effect of moisture in the air. Factors such as metabolic variations, being pregnant, and physical activity can impact an individual's weather perception. Consider the sun's direct rays and their impact; they can potentially increase the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are especially vital to children. Kids generally face higher risks than adults as they sweat less. Along with their large skin surface compared to their small bodies and higher heat production due to their activities, their vulnerability is increased.
To offset high temperatures, the human body releases sweat which, upon evaporation, cools it down. With higher relative humidity, the rate of evaporation is reduced, resulting in increased heat retention in the body compared to drier air. Elevated heat gain compared to the body's release capability poses risks of dehydration and potential overheating.

Rainfall

In Youngs Creek, in August, during 15.9 rainfall days, 2.8" (71m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Youngs Creek, during the entire year, the rain falls for 175.7 days and collects up to 39.53" (1004mm) of precipitation.

Daylight

In Youngs Creek, the average length of the day in August is 13h and 32min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 6:43 am and sunset at 8:43 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:07 am and sunset at 8:06 pm EDT.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are May through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: A typical high UV index of 6 in August suggests the following recommendations:
Uphold preventive measures and conform to sun safety guidelines. Defending against skin and eye harm is crucial. Try to minimize direct S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ation. Also note that objects like parasols or canopies might not provide complete sun protection. Sunglasses that guard against UVA and UVB rays are pivotal in minimizing sun-induced ocular damage.
